Pomegranate Blueberry and Goat Cheese Crostini

Ingredients
- Ingredients for fruit:
- 1/2cup1/2 cup of pomegranate juice
- 2cups2 cups of frozen blueberries
- juice from 1/2 lemon
- 1/4cup1/4 cup of sugar
- 1Tablespoon1 Tablespoon of honey
- pinchpinch of cinnamon
- seeds from 1/2 pomegranate
- For serving:
- 11 baguette, sliced into 1/4-1/2 inch thick slices and toasted
- log of softened goat cheese
- honey for drizzling

Preparation
Step 1
1. Place pomegranate juice, blueberries, lemon juice, sugar, honey and cinnamon in a small saucepan. Bring to bo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er until fruit is softened and mixture is thick and syrupy, about 10 minutes.
2. Allow fruit to cool slightly. Stir in pomegranate seeds. Mixture can be served warm or at room temp.
3. To serve: Spread toasted baguette slices with softened goat cheese. Top with teaspoon of fruit mixture and drizzle with honey. Serve warm or room temp.
